Subject: [PATCH v4 0/2] Improve optimal IO size initialization

A couple of patches to improve setting the optimal I/O size limit of
scsi disks. A fallback default is added to make sure we always have a
non-zero optimal I/O size so that file systems operate with a
reasonnably sized default read_ahead_kb value, for improving buffered
read performance.
Changes from v1:
- Changed message level from wrong WARNING level to INFO level
- Added review tag
Changes from v2:
- Added patch 1
- Make sure we do not overflow variables and limits in patch 2
Changes from v3:
- Change logical_to_bytes() to return a u64 in patch 1
- Added review tag to patch 2
Damien Le Moal (2):
scsi: sd: Prevent logical_to_bytes() from returning overflowed values
scsi: sd: Set a default optimal IO size if one is not defined
